HI David, On 28/02/11 16:57, David Grellscheid wrote: > ATLAS_2010_S8919674 (W+jets) uses a LeadingParticlesFS to make up > pTmiss. Does that make sense? Shouldn't I add all neutrinos? How would I > even know how the experimental pTmiss divides over the neutrinos? Unfortunately this analysis (like some others) corrects to pTmiss="neutrino from the W" for the particle level distributions. Since that is not possible to implement in a generator-independent analysis I used the leading neutrino as closest match. This seems to be a very good approximation, as I validated the analysis by reproducing the Sherpa predictions in the paper using the same ATLAS-internal MC samples. Cheers, Frank
